Utah has experienced many earthquakes, large and small, because of its abundance of faults and fault zones. Some of the most active faults in Utah include the Wasatch fault along the Wasatch Front, the Hurricane fault in Southern Utah, and the Needles fault zone in Canyonlands National Park. While Utah is not on a boundary between tectonic plates where most of the world's earthquakes occur, it is in the tectonically extending western part of the North American plate. Thus, earthquakes in Utah are related to interactions with the Pacific plate along the plate margin on the west coast of the United States. Also of note, earthquakes of magnitude 10 or larger cannot happen. The magnitude of an earthquake is related to the length of the fault on which it occurs. The largest earthquake ever recorded was a magnitude 9.5 on May 22, 1960 in Chile on a fault that is almost 1,000 miles long… a “megaquake” in its own right.

What is Earthquake Insurance? Earthquake insurance is a form of ‘property insurance’ that pays the policyholder in the event where an earthquake damages a property. Most homeowners’ insurance policies do not cover earthquake damage … unless … it is specifically endorsed or added to the policy. In Utah, you can purchase an earthquake insurance policy either with your home insurance policy or separate from your home insurance policy. An earthquake (also known as a quake, tremor or temblor) is the shaking of the surface of the Earth resulting from a sudden release of energy in the Earth's lithosphere that creates seismic waves. Earthquakes can range in size from those that are so weak that they cannot be felt to those violent enough to propel objects and people into the air, and wreak destruction across entire cities. The seismicity, or seismic activity, of an area is the frequency, type, and size of earthquakes experienced over a period of time. The word tremor is also used for non-earthquake seismic rumbling. At the Earth's surface, earthquakes manifest themselves by shaking and displacing or disrupting the ground. When the epicenter of a large earthquake is located offshore, the seabed may be displaced sufficiently to cause a tsunami. Earthquakes can also trigger landslides and occasionally, volcanic activity. In its most general sense, the word earthquake is used to describe any seismic event—whether natural or caused by humans—that generates seismic waves. Earthquakes are caused mostly by rupture of geological faults but also by other events such as volcanic activity, landslides, mine blasts, and nuclear tests. An earthquake's point of initial rupture is called its hypocenter or focus. The epicenter is the point at ground level directly above the hypocenter.

How much is Utah earthquake insurance? The cost of Earthquake insurance in Utah will depend on several factors, specifically related to the home, location, coverage amount, and owners of the property. You should expect to pay anywhere from $400 to $1500 per year, depending on these factors. There are 4 important factors to consider when buying Earthquake Insurance in Utah! The pivotal items are: (1) Risk of an earthquake – If (and when) we have an earthquake in Utah, what are the risks to you, your family, and your property? If your home is damaged, do you have the means to rebuild/replace your home, contents and have a place to live while your home is being repaired? (2) Value of home – The value of your home, and the equity you have in your home, play a role in determining how much earthquake coverage you need. The more equity you have, the more important it is to protect that equity from all risks, including an earthquake. (3) Deductible – The deductible is the amount you pay first before your insurance kicks in to pay for any damage. Most earthquake policies will have a percentage deductible vs a flat fee deductible. The percentage of the deductible is based on the value of your home or the amount of coverage you purchase. (4) Contents coverage – Contents are your personal belongings. Contents coverage covers things like clothes, shoes, kitchenware, TV’s, and computers. Anything you would pack up and take with you if you sold your home would be considered content. It’s important when considering an earthquake policy to determine how much contents coverage you need.

Basic Earthquake Package: Protection just for the dwelling for half the cost. If you don’t think you need out building, personal property and loss of use coverage, you will love our basic package with 2 deductible options: (1) 5% Deductible excludes masonry/masonry veneer and (2) 10% includes brick veneer.

b.
Standard Earthquake Package: This package includes personal property and loss of use. It is customizable to meet your specific needs. Package includes: (1) Dwelling, (2) Personal property (30% of dwelling amount) Can increase up to 50% of dwelling amount. (3) Loss of Use (10% of dwelling amount) Can increase up to 20% of dwelling amount. (4) Choose deductible: 5% Deductible excludes masonry/masonry veneer, 10% includes brick veneer

c.
Optional Earthquake Coverages …
(1) Personal Property: Increase up to 50% of dwelling limit. (2) Loss of Use: Increase up to 20% of dwelling limit. (3) Other Structures: Add coverage for detached structures up to $100,000 in value. (4) Building Code Upgrades: Add coverage up to $50,000. (5) Earthquake Loss Assessment: Unique coverage for condo owners. Provides coverage when the condo association assesses condo owner an amount to help rebuild structures not covered on the master policy. Can add up to $250,000 limit.
